Wilton Bicyclist Hospitalized After Being Hit By Norwalk Transit Bus

WILTON, Conn. — A 22-year-old Wilton man was hospitalized Wednesday evening after he was struck by a Norwalk Transit District bus while riding his bicycle, police said.

The accident happened at about 5:10 p.m. on Route 7, just south of Arrowhead Road, Lt. Donald Wakeman said. The bus, driven by a 52-year-old man, was traveling north in the right lane when it made contact with the bicyclist, who was riding in the northbound shoulder, Wakeman said.

The bicyclist was knocked to the ground and was later transported to Norwalk Hospital by Wilton EMS, Wakeman said. As of Friday, the extent of the man’s injuries was unknown and the case remained open pending further investigation, Wakeman said.
